20 Easy Heatless Curls For Long Thick Hair That Actually Work

Achieving salon-quality volume without a drop of heat is the ultimate goal for anyone managing long thick hair in 2026. While high-temperature wands often lead to split ends and moisture loss, heatless curls for long thick hair offer a restorative alternative that works while you sleep. The challenge with dense, heavy strands is ensuring the curl sets deeply enough to defy gravity throughout the day. Modern techniques have evolved beyond simple braids, utilizing silk ribbons, flexi-rods, and even common household items to create everything from tight ringlets to soft Hollywood waves. By mastering these methods, you can protect your hair’s structural integrity while enjoying consistent, bouncy results that look professionally styled every single morning.

1. Silk Heatless Curling Rod

Using a long silk-covered foam rod is currently the most popular way to achieve uniform waves on heavy hair. You begin by placing the rod across the top of your head, securing it with a large claw clip. Starting from the front, wrap small sections of damp hair away from your face around the rod, gradually incorporating more hair as you move down. For thick hair, it is vital to keep the tension high and the sections relatively small to ensure the core of the strand dries completely. Secure the ends with silk scrunchies to prevent creasing. This method creates a polished, blowout look with significant volume at the mid-lengths and ends.

2. Jumbo Satin Flexi Rods

Flexi rods are an exceptional choice for thick manes because they allow for more localized control over the curl pattern. Unlike a single long rod, using four to six jumbo-sized flexi rods lets you divide your hair into manageable quadrants. You simply wrap a section of hair around the soft, pliable rod and fold the ends inward to lock it in place. Because these rods are thicker, they create large, loopy curls that mimic a 2-inch curling iron. The satin coating is essential for thick hair as it reduces friction and prevents the frizz that often occurs when heavy strands rub against traditional foam or cotton materials.

3. Overnight Robe Tie Curls

The robe tie method remains a viral favorite because it utilizes a plush, thick fabric that provides a sturdy base for heavy hair. You take a standard bathrobe belt and drape it over your head, then use a French braiding motion to wrap your hair around it. The thickness of the robe tie is actually an advantage for long hair, as it creates a wider curl diameter that looks more natural and less like tight “sausage” curls. For the best results, ensure your hair is about 80% dry before wrapping. This allows the fabric to absorb the remaining moisture, helping the style set firmly without requiring hours of air-drying.

4. Large Sock Curls

Socks are surprisingly effective tools for creating bouncy, heatless ringlets on long hair because the cotton or wool provides excellent grip. You start by cutting the toe off a clean, long tube sock and rolling it into a “donut” or simply using it as a flexible rod. For thick hair, using four to five socks is better than just two. Wrap each section from the ends up to the mid-shaft and tie the sock ends together. The benefit of socks is their comfort; they are soft enough for side sleepers while being sturdy enough to hold the weight of long, dense hair without slipping out during the night.

5. French Braid Waves

French braiding is the classic go-to for creating a crimped, beachy texture on thick hair without any specialized equipment. To avoid the flat-root look often associated with basic braids, start the French braid as high up on the crown as possible. For very thick hair, two braids are usually better than one, as a single large braid may not allow the inner hair to dry, resulting in limp waves. This method works best on hair that has a bit of “grit” from a sea salt spray or lightweight mousse. Once unraveled, the result is a consistent, zig-zag wave pattern that adds immense volume and movement.

6. Octocurl Heatless System

The Octocurl is a specialized tool featuring a headband with multiple hanging fabric strips, resembling an octopus. This design is perfect for thick hair because it allows you to distribute the hair’s weight across eight or more individual strips. By wrapping smaller sections of hair around each strip, you ensure that every strand gets equal air circulation and set time. You can choose to wrap the hair flat for wide waves or twist it for tighter spiral curls. This system is particularly useful for those who find a single thick rod too bulky or uncomfortable for sleeping, providing a more customizable curling experience.

7. Pop Can Rollers

Using clean, empty soda cans as rollers is a retro hack that has made a comeback for those seeking maximum “90s supermodel” volume. The large circumference of a can is ideal for long hair, creating a very soft, rounded bend rather than a tight curl. You simply roll the hair around the can and secure it with a large elastic or clip. While not the most comfortable for sleeping, this method is excellent for a “day-time set” while you get ready. The aluminum helps retain a tiny bit of natural body heat from the scalp, which can help set the style faster on thick, stubborn hair.

8. T-Shirt Halo Method

The T-shirt halo involves twisting a soft cotton shirt into a ring and placing it on top of the head like a crown. You then tuck and wrap sections of hair over and under the ring. This is one of the gentlest methods for thick hair, as the cotton jersey material is smooth and breathable. It creates a very soft, romantic wave that starts higher up on the head compared to rod methods. Because the hair is gathered on top of the head, this technique also provides a natural “root lift,” preventing the weight of thick hair from making the top of the style look flat.

9. Leggings Curling Method

Similar to the robe tie, using a pair of leggings provides a thick, stretchy base for wrapping long hair. You place the crotch of the leggings on your head with the legs hanging down. The spandex in the leggings provides great tension, which is key for getting curls to stay in thick hair. You wrap the hair around each leg and can even pull the “waist” of the leggings over your hair like a cap to keep everything secure. This is an incredibly comfortable way to sleep, and the thickness of the legging legs results in beautiful, large-scale waves that look effortless.

10. Multi-Strand Rope Braids

Rope braids involve twisting two sections of hair around each other to create a spiral effect. Unlike a three-strand braid which can look crimped, a rope braid produces a more polished, twisted curl. For long thick hair, creating four to six rope braids around the head ensures that the hair is sufficiently divided for drying. This technique is excellent for those who want a “bohemian” look with lots of definition. To prevent the twists from unraveling, apply a light styling cream to each section before you start. The result is a sleek, rope-like wave that holds its shape for days.

11. Cretonne Ribbon Wrap

A Cretonne or stiff fabric ribbon can be used to create very defined, vintage-style curls. Unlike soft silk, a stiffer ribbon provides more structure, which helps thick hair maintain its shape once it is released. You wrap the hair in a spiral fashion down the length of the ribbon. This method is often preferred by those with very long hair, as the ribbon can be as long as needed to accommodate the entire length of the strand. When removed, the hair falls into structured, elegant spirals that can be brushed out into soft, glamorous “Old Hollywood” waves with a wide-tooth comb.

12. Pigtail Bun Waves

Creating two high pigtail buns is a simple yet effective way to get volume and large waves at the same time. After washing and drying your hair to about 90%, split it down the middle and create two high ponytails. Twist each ponytail tightly until it coils into a bun and secure it with a soft scrunchie. Because the buns are on top of the head, the weight of the thick hair actually helps to press the curls into place. When you let them down, you get a beautiful lift at the roots and a soft, tumbling wave throughout the rest of the hair.

13. Finger Coiling Technique

Finger coiling is a more manual approach that is excellent for those with naturally wavy hair that needs definition. You take small sections of damp hair and twirl them around your finger into a tight spiral. For thick hair, this can be time-consuming but the results are highly defined and uniform. Once each section is coiled, you can leave it to air-dry completely. The smaller the coil, the tighter the curl will be. For long thick hair, you can use a bit of gel or mousse to give the curls more longevity and to prevent frizz.

14. Large Roller Set

Traditional large rollers are still one of the most reliable ways to achieve a blowout look without heat. For thick hair, you’ll need at least 12 to 15 large rollers to ensure each section is small enough to dry properly. Velcro rollers are popular for their ease of use, but foam rollers are more comfortable for sleeping. The large size of the roller provides a classic, rounded end to the hair, which is perfect for those who want their long, thick hair to look full and bouncy rather than tightly curled.

15. Scarf Wrap Curls

Using a silk or satin scarf to wrap the hair is a multi-functional method that curls and protects at the same time. You can use the scarf as a ribbon or wrap your hair around it in a “halo” fashion. For thick hair, the scarf provides a larger surface area for the hair to dry on, preventing the hair from becoming a damp mess inside a single rod. The silk fabric also keeps the cuticle layer of the hair flat, resulting in much shinier and smoother curls that are less prone to tangling throughout the day.

16. Twist Braid Curls

Twist braids are similar to rope braids but are done as a series of two-strand twists that are more tightly wound. For thick hair, this technique is excellent for creating a textured, beachy wave that looks more structured than a regular braid. You start by dividing the hair into four main quadrants and then doing two-strand twists in each section. This method is very comfortable for sleeping and ensures that even the inner layers of thick hair are fully curled, providing a uniform texture from root to tip.

17. Headband Loop Method

The headband loop is a very quick and easy way to get soft, romantic waves in a matter of hours. You place a soft, elastic headband around your head like a crown and then loop sections of hair over and under it until all of your hair is tucked in. This creates a “Gibson Tuck” style while the hair is setting. For thick hair, you may need a thicker, wider headband to accommodate all of the weight. This is a great “at-home” style that looks polished while your hair is actually being curled.

18. Paper Towel Rollers

This is an old-school DIY hack that works surprisingly well for thick hair. You take a few sheets of paper towel, roll them into a tight cylinder, and use them as soft, disposable rollers. Because the paper is absorbent, it helps to pull moisture out of thick hair more quickly than a silk or satin rod. This can significantly speed up the drying time, which is often the biggest challenge for those with long, dense hair. When unrolled, the paper towel rollers leave you with soft, medium-sized curls.

19. Ribbon Braid Curls

Ribbon braiding involves braiding a ribbon into a standard three-strand braid to give it more structure and a wider diameter. For thick hair, the ribbon acts as a spacer, preventing the hair from being squeezed too tightly together in the braid. This results in a much larger wave pattern that looks more like a salon blowout than a traditional braid-out. You can use multiple ribbons for more definition or just one large ribbon in a single braid for a very soft, subtle wave.

20. Bun-To-Beach Waves

For the most minimal effort, creating a series of small, twisted buns is the way to go. You divide your hair into four or more sections, twist each into a tiny “Bantu knot” or bun, and secure them close to the scalp. This method creates a highly textured, wavy look that is full of volume. For long thick hair, having multiple small buns instead of one large one is key to ensuring that the hair dries completely. Once unraveled and shaken out, the result is a massive, voluminous mane of waves.
